Output ca0cf4334933ea5ce25d8ec4e3344da73e41520d84d189fdcc2c86bf191c2462:7

value
5796803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1faf51d1ec53b371b8d55d34ce4888219d952780 OP_EQUAL
address
34aYtumDu6KBcCwj8utQuB5fEUdnTVf8dx
transaction
ca0cf4334933ea5ce25d8ec4e3344da73e41520d84d189fdcc2c86bf191c2462
confirmations
496107
spent
true